Freedoms satisfactory: poll

Residents are generally satisfied with the level of day-to-day freedom, but are concerned about the development of a more democratic system of government, according to a recent survey.

Of the 891 people questioned, 43 per cent said they were satisfied with the Government's handling of freedom of speech, assembly and protest activities.
